Beckhams becoming Scientologists?
Tom Cruise has been practicing his powers of persuasion on Britain's second royal family: the Beckhams. "Queen" Victoria, formerly known as "Posh Spice," has been spotted in Los Angeles carrying around a book by the founder of Scientology, L. Ron Hubbard. British newspaper, the Sun, suggests that Cruise's fiancee, Katie Holmes may have recommended the book, Assists For Illnesses and Injuries, to Victoria after her son was stricken with a mysterious condition. Scientologists believe that certain illnesses may be cured by a type of touching called Assists. Holmes may have referred Beckham to Assists when they sat together recently in the front row of Rock and Republic's LA fashion show. If Victoria becomes a convert to Scientology, this could be a huge coup for the religion. She and her husband, Real Madrid soccer player, David Beckham, are two of Britain's most recognizable stars. Tom Cruise is believed to have been trying to convert his famous friends for some time. (By Kate Lanahan)
